My experience with the GOG Galaxy/Steam integration was also very spotty (I got tons of the infamous "Offline/Retry" error). Last thing I did that seemed to almost solve it was the procedure described here, which seemed to help (note how it instructs you to delete the plugin in TWO different places in your computer). Yes, it took a while to have my ~2000 game Steam library to sync, but it seemed to work fine after that.

GOG Galaxy is a nice idea in principle - one launcher to rule them all and your whole game collection in one place. But the Steam extension particularly causes a lot of problems as is obvious looking at the GOG forums. I tried to get it to work over months until I gave up.
Most users reporting problems have large Steam libraries with thousands of games which the GOG integration seems unable to handle.
